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) has become a vital component of modern business strategies. It involves companies taking responsibility for their impact on society and the environment. As consumers become more conscious, CSR initiatives can significantly influence a company’s brand authority.
Understanding Corporate Social Responsibility
CSR encompasses a wide range of activities, including environmental sustainability, ethical labor practices, community engagement, and philanthropy. These efforts demonstrate a company’s commitment to positive social impact beyond profit-making.
The Relationship Between CSR and Brand Authority
Brand authority refers to the level of trust and credibility a brand holds in the minds of consumers. CSR initiatives can enhance this authority by showing that a company values ethical practices and social responsibility. When consumers see genuine efforts, they are more likely to trust and support the brand.
Building Trust and Loyalty
Companies that actively participate in CSR can foster stronger customer loyalty. Consumers tend to prefer brands that align with their values, and transparent CSR efforts can create emotional connections, leading to long-term loyalty.
Enhancing Reputation and Competitive Advantage
Effective CSR initiatives can boost a company’s reputation, making it stand out in a crowded marketplace. A strong reputation for social responsibility can also serve as a competitive advantage, attracting customers, investors, and talented employees.
Challenges and Considerations
While CSR offers many benefits, it also presents challenges. Companies must ensure their initiatives are authentic and not merely performative. Insincere efforts can damage credibility and harm brand authority.
Transparency, consistent action, and engaging stakeholders are essential for successful CSR programs. Companies should also measure and communicate the impact of their initiatives to maintain trust.
